> > > Anyway, do we really need a bug on for this? Has this actually caught
> > > any wrong usage? VM_BUG_ON tends to be enabled these days AFAIK and
> > > panicking the kernel seems like an over-reaction. If there is a real
> > > risk then why don't we simply mask __GFP_HIGHMEM off when calling
> > > alloc_pages?

> > Subject: [PATCH] mm: drop VM_BUG_ON from __get_free_pages
> >
> > There is no real reason to blow up just because the caller doesn't know
> > that __get_free_pages cannot return highmem pages. Simply fix that up
> > silently. Even if we have some confused users such a fixup will not be
> > harmful.
>
> mm... So we have a caller which hopes to be getting highmem pages but
> isn't. Caller then proceeds to pointlessly kmap the page and wonders
> why it isn't getting as much memory as it would like on 32-bit systems,
> etc.

How he can kmap the page when he gets a _virtual_ address?

> I do think we should help ferret out such bogosity. A WARN_ON_ONCE
> would suffice.

This function has always been about lowmem pages. I seriously doubt we
have anybody confused and asking for a highmem page in the kernel. I
haven't checked that but it would already blow up as VM_BUG_ON tends to
be enabled on many setups.
